KIEV, August 04./ITAR-TASS/. Ukrainian army units taking part in a security operation in eastern Ukraine will not use heavy artillery and aviation to liberate Donetsk and Luhansk from militias, Zoran Shkiryak, the Ukrainian Interior Ministry’s adviser, said quoted by the Ukrinform news agency on Monday.

“We are categorically against using these means (artillery and aviation) which can create a threat to civilian lives. This is a position of principle of the Ukraine’s army commander-in-chief and commanders in charge of the ground operation,” Shkiryak said.

He said the Ukrainian army and National Guard units would carry out a ground operation to liberate the populated localities in Eastern Ukraine from militias who would be in for a few surprises.

Meanwhile, the Donetsk city administration reported on Monday that the city had come under artillery fire last night.

“Explosions and artillery shots could be heard throughout the city. Besides, the city’s residential areas and social infrastructure have been shelled from heavy guns since Monday morning,” the city administration source said.
